Back on Trach?

The Mets got a much needed win last night behind some good pitching and timely hitting. Steve Trachsel only mistake was Barry Bonds 710th career home run in the second inning. Beyond that Trachsel was solid.

Carlos Beltran sat out again. He hasn’t played since April 21. I think the team really needs to make a decision on Beltran. Jose Valentin‘s appearance as a pinch hitter last night is a clear indication that Beltran isn’t well enough to hit. Clearly an assesment needs to be made on putting him on the DL. If he can’t be ready by the Atlanta series then you’ve given up a roster spot for a week and may as well just DL him to open up that spot for someone else why Beltran gets better. Let’s not waste time on this one.

Good, bad and ugly from last night’s game
The Good – Steve Trachsel (6 IP, 3H, 1 ER, 2 BB, 2 K)
The Bad – Jamey Wright, SF (8 IP, 10 H, 4 ER)
The Ugly – Endy Chavez (0 for 3, 2 K, average down to .171)
